Is Quviviq covered by Medicare, and what would a beneficiary pay?

Currently, Medicare prescription drug plans (Part D) typically do not include Quviviq on their formularies. If you have a plan that does provide coverage, your out-of-pocket cost will depend on your plan's deductible, copay, and coverage phase. For beneficiaries without coverage, the retail cost for 30 tablets of Quviviq 50mg is high, but pharmacy discount programs can sometimes provide savings. Always confirm with your plan administrator or pharmacist for the most accurate and current information.

Can I get a generic version of Quviviq?

No, a generic version of daridorexant is not yet available. Quviviq is under patent protection, which is expected to last until approximately 2027. Until a generic version enters the market, patients must rely on the brand-name product. To help manage the cost, exploring manufacturer savings programs, pharmacy discounts, or discussing alternative therapies with your doctor are potential options.
